TWINS Laura and Rachel Swan, aged 16, were top of the class when they picked up their GCSE results.

Laura's result of nine A* and one A earned her top place at her school and her sister's exceptional result in her English literature exam was one of the top five marks in the country.

Laura said: "I was surprised. I thought I had done well but not this well. I can't believe I am the highest achieving pupil this year."

Rachel added: "The stress levels in the house were quite high but we supported each other when it came too much. It helped that we were both going through it at the same time. But getting your results makes all the hard work really worthwhile."

The girls are both pupils at Westhoughton High School.
